Simple Pizza Dough Recipe

Ingredients

650g/1lb 5oz Italian '00' (Strong Flour)

7g sachet easy blend yeast (you'll find it in any supermarket, baking goods section, dry yeast)

2 tsp Salt

25ml/1floz Olive Oil

50ml/2fl oz warm milk

325ml/11floz warm water

Method

Mix the flour, yeast and salt together in a large mixing bowl and stir in the olive oil and milk.

Gradually add the water, mixing well to form a soft dough.

Turn the dough out on to a floured work surface and knead for about five minutes, until smooth and elastic.  Transfer to a clean bowl, cover with a damp tea towel and leave to rise for about 1 1/2 hours, until doubled in size.

 

When the dough has rizen, knock it back then knead again until smooth, roll into a ball and set aside for 30 minutes to 1 hour until risen again.  

Preheat the oven to its highest setting.  Divide into six balls and roll each out onto a lightly floured work surface until 20cm/8in in diameter.  Spread a little passata over each pizza base and top with your favourite toppings.  Bake the pizzas in the oven until the bases are crisp and golden-brown around the edges and any cheese on the topping has melted.

 

ote: Italian "00" flour makes pizzas lighter and crispier and pasta lighter
